Job description

Texas Monthly is looking for a deputy editor, who will report to the editor in chief and work closely with that position to execute their vision for the magazine across all its journalism platforms. The deputy editor will be a vital partner to the editor in chief and the director of operations in shaping the future of Texas Monthly and ensuring that the magazine consistently produces some of the highest-quality storytelling in the nation. The deputy editor will directly supervise multiple editors, who in turn oversee all the magazine’s writers and editors. This editor should be enthusiastic about coaching and providing feedback to editors at various levels of experience, including on assignment strategy, story structure, line editing, and leadership/management skills, to elevate Texas Monthly’s journalism and aim to grow its audience.

This full-time staff position is based in Austin, Texas, and requires working regularly out of our downtown office. It offers stability and the opportunity to significantly shape a nationally renowned media company that received a National Magazine Award for general excellence in 2026 and whose culture is defined by collegiality, curiosity, ambition, experimentation, the highest journalistic standards, and an abiding sense of service to our millions of readers both in and outside of Texas. This position offers generous benefits, including a comprehensive health-insurance plan, 401(k) matching, profit sharing, and eligibility for performance-based bonuses.

The deputy editor will:
  • Supervise the story director and multiple executive editors, who in turn oversee all the magazine’s writers and editors
  • Work with editors, the editor in chief, and the print managing editor to curate a variety of timely and engaging stories within each print issue, and to ensure a compelling and varied lineup of cover stories
  • Work with editors and the digital managing editor to refine and enforce an editorial vision and publishing cadence for texasmonthly.com
  • Provide editing and assigning feedback to editors, including through top edits of stories
  • Occasionally assign and edit stories, including approximately six longform feature stories a year
  • Provide editorial feedback on other publishing platforms, such as video and podcasts, as delegated by the editor in chief
  • Collaborate closely with the editor in chief and director of editorial operations on strategy, including deciding whether and when to launch new editorial products and how to best deploy the department’s sixty-plus staffers across its many initiatives
  • Help guide conversations across the editorial staff about the types of stories Texas Monthly wants to tell and how it wants to tell the
Successful candidates will possess the following:
  • Experience in, and enthusiasm for, managing other editors and coaching them on how to effectively supervise and edit writers
  • Exceptional editing abilities, from the structural level to the line level, including on longform features
  • A talent for writing clear and compelling display type, including cover lines
  • A friendly, collaborative, and communicative work style
Previous experience/education:
  • Bachelor’s degree
  • At least ten years of editing experience at a magazine or similar publication that publishes longform journalism
  • At least five years of experience leading and supervising teams of journalists
